Re: verizon to sprint apache

C'mon buddy, SEARCH! We have seen this SO MANY times. Verizon will activate another carriers ESN so you could use a Sprint one on Verizon. But you can't activate a non-native ESN on Sprint. This site does not support ESN changing so will need to go somewhere else to do that. I don't know anyone who has another phone working on Sprint.
